🚇 🗺️ Getting There
The entrance is discreetly located within the Morelli Parking garage on Via Domenico Morelli. Look for the pedestrian entrance and follow the tunnel inside for about 100 meters.
Yes, it's centrally located and accessible via public transport. The nearest metro stations are Toledo or Dante, followed by a walk.
From Piazza Plebiscito, head towards the seafront towards Castel dell'Ovo, then proceed to Galleria Borbonica. You'll pass Palazzo Mannajuolo and take Via Vito Fornari, then Salita Vetriera, and finally Salita Betlemme.
Signs outside the tunnel are minimal, making it easy to miss. The key is to look for the Morelli Parking entrance.
Tours are generally required, and guides are highly recommended for the best experience. Some visitors expressed a preference for independent exploration, but the guided tours are informative.

🎫 🧭 Onsite Experience
The Adventure Route involves wearing a helmet and using a flashlight to explore deeper sections, including a raft journey on underground water.
Guides share fascinating stories about the tunnel's history, including its use as an escape route, a refuge during wartime, and its discovery.
The tunnels involve steep steps down and uneven terrain. While the main paths are steady, some sections might be challenging for those with significant mobility issues.
